Blue Man Group To Visit Soldiers And Sailors Memorial Auditorium On Jan. 27

  • Tuesday, January 13, 2015

NETworks Presentations, LLC and Blue Man Productions announce a new theatrical touring production will visit Chattanooga's Soldiers and Sailors Memorial Auditorium for one performance only Tuesday, Jan. 27 at 7:30 p.m. Tickets are on sale at the Auditorium box office, 399 McCallie Ave., by phone 800-514-3849, or online at www.ChattanoogaOnStage.com.

The theatrical tour features brand new content highlighted by classic Blue Man favorites.  The new sound, set, and video design centering around a proscenium-sized LED curtain and high-resolution screen create an entirely new, high-impact visual experience for Broadway houses across the nation.

The critically acclaimed Blue Man Group creates experiences that defy categorization. Blue Man Group is best known for multi-media performances that feature three bald and blue characters who take the audience on a journey that is funny, intelligent and visually stunning. A live band, whose haunting tribal rhythms help drive the show to its climax, accompanies the Blue Men.

"In order to create a touring version of our theatrical production, we knew we had a creative challenge to tackle," says Blue Man Group Co-Founder Philip Stanton. "We needed to find a way to transform theatres of all shapes and sizes into spaces in which the Blue Man can intimately connect with the audience, where the audience can become engaged with the spirit of the show and the Blue Man himself. We think we have finally figured it out, and hopefully we will accomplish our goal, which is always to help audience members reconnect with their own sense of wonder and discovery, with their own sense of what is possible in their lives."
